She stated that officials are \u201cfeeling good about the prospects of a deal,\u201d adding that future negotiations would \u201cvery likely\u201d be hosted in Islamabad.<\/p>\n<p>Leavitt dismissed reports suggesting that Washington had requested an extension of the current ceasefire, calling such claims \u201cbad reporting\u201d and inaccurate. She emphasized that diplomatic engagement remains ongoing and productive, noting that both Donald Trump and JD Vance have expressed confidence in the negotiation process.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Pakistan\u2019s Role as Key Mediator Praised<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>The White House highlighted Pakistan\u2019s central role in facilitating communication between Washington and Tehran. Leavitt described Pakistan as an \u201cincredible mediator,\u201d noting that it has been instrumental in keeping negotiations on track.<\/p>\n<p>Despite offers from multiple countries to assist, President Trump has reportedly chosen to streamline diplomatic efforts through Pakistan alone to ensure efficiency and clarity in communication.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Trump Claims China Will Not Arm Iran<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>In a separate development, President Trump stated that China has agreed not to supply weapons to Iran, a move he suggested could significantly reduce regional tensions.<\/p>\n<p>Posting on his Truth Social platform, Trump also announced his intention to permanently reopen the Strait of Hormuz, a vital global oil transit route.<\/p>\n<p>He claimed that Chinese President Xi Jinping supports the decision and indicated an upcoming visit to Beijing on May 14\u201315\u2014his first trip to China during his second presidential term.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Naval Blockade Raises Tensions Despite Talks<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>Tensions remain high following the US decision to impose a naval blockade on Iran, effectively halting maritime trade. The blockade, implemented earlier this week, has already disrupted oil shipments and commercial traffic, which accounts for roughly 90% of Iran\u2019s economy.<\/p>\n<p>Trump described the ongoing war as \u201cvery close to over\u201d in an interview, suggesting that a resolution could come either through diplomacy or decisive military action.<\/p>\n<p>However, Iranian officials have warned that the blockade could violate the ceasefire and provoke retaliation. Senior military commander Ali Abdollahi stated that Iran may respond by shutting down trade routes across the Persian Gulf, the Sea of Oman, and the Red Sea if the blockade continues.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Iran Signals Willingness for Dialogue, Rejects Pressure<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>Iranian leadership has maintained that it seeks dialogue rather than conflict. President Masoud Pezeshkian reiterated that Iran \u201cdoes not seek war or instability,\u201d while warning that any attempt to impose foreign will on the country would fail.<\/p>\n<p>Meanwhile, Foreign Ministry spokesperson Esmaeil Baghaei confirmed that communication between Iran and the US is continuing indirectly through Pakistan. A Pakistani delegation is expected to arrive in Tehran to deliver further messages as part of ongoing diplomatic exchanges.<\/p>\n<p>Sticking Points: Nuclear Program and Sanctions<\/p>\n<p>Despite progress, significant disagreements remain. A key issue is Iran\u2019s nuclear program:<\/p>\n<p>The US has proposed a 20-year suspension of nuclear activity<\/p>\n<p>Iran has suggested a shorter 3\u20135 year pause<\/p>\n<p>Additionally, Washington insists that Iran export its enriched nuclear material, while Tehran demands the lifting of international sanctions.<\/p>\n<p>Rafael Grossi, head of the International Atomic Energy Agency, noted that the duration of any agreement would ultimately be a political decision and hinted that compromise may be possible.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Regional Conflict Complicates Peace Efforts<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>The situation is further complicated by ongoing military actions involving Israel and Hezbollah in Lebanon. While the US and Israel argue these operations fall outside the ceasefire, Iran maintains they are connected.<\/p>\n<p>The conflict, which began on February 28, has resulted in approximately 5,000 deaths, including casualties in both Iran and Lebanon.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Global Impact and Economic Reactions<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>The conflict has had a major impact on global markets, particularly energy. The disruption of the Strait of Hormuz\u2014through which a significant portion of the world\u2019s oil passes\u2014has affected supply chains across Asia and Europe.<\/p>\n<p>However, renewed diplomatic optimism has helped stabilize markets slightly, with oil prices falling and Asian stock markets showing gains.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Outlook: Fragile Optimism Amid Uncertainty<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>While both sides appear open to negotiations, the situation remains fragile. US officials suggest talks could resume within days in Islamabad, though no official date has been confirmed.<\/p>\n<p>President Trump expressed confidence that a deal is achievable, stating that Iran is eager to negotiate.
